Output 603a1254df21df74bb4ba6f80cd21d534a1ccf68f0c578428ee179694797f534:0

value
378949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a591de7980a84e736a3d7deb8c31ea04c214c80 OP_EQUAL
address
32djSQZ9AWGWKKhM7YTF4vBEksM2oJmPQ4
transaction
603a1254df21df74bb4ba6f80cd21d534a1ccf68f0c578428ee179694797f534
spent
true